Abstract: The shape of the emittance contour of a charged particle beam can be described by the contour function. In this paper the variance of the beam contour in nonlinear transport system is studied by means of the contour function theory and Lie algebra. Its inverse problem, the selection of parameters of the transport system according to the beam properties, can be studied also. As examples, the improvement of the beam quality by means of the nonlinear element and the beam matching in the nonlinear periodic field system are discussed.
